The role of the Field Nurse Supervisor is to provide professional nursing services in compliance with governmental regulations, individual State Nursing Practice Acts and Premier policies, procedures and philosophies.
Qualifications:
- Educational: Minimum of R.N. Diploma from an NLN approved Nursing Program
- Travel: Travel may be required for business purposes. If so, the employee must have a valid driver’s license issued by the state in which they work and a satisfactory driving record.
- Work Experience: Minimum of one year of experience in medical surgical nursing preferably hospital based preferred. One additional year of home-health based experience is required for conducting applicable training classes.
- Bilingual (Spanish) preferred.
- Must maintain all state and federal compliance requirements for licensure and employment.
Additional Requirements:
- Knowledge of regulatory requirements to Joint Commission/CAHC/DOH
- Fundamental knowledge of the basic principles of nursing and the ability to apply these principles in a home care setting
- Ability to accurately assess patient health care status and psycho social needs
- Ability to establish a Plan of Care which will assist the patient to reach desirable health status
- Ability to function with minimal supervision
- Reliable means of transportation.
Essential Job Responsibilities:
- Institute contact with physicians as necessary.
- Confer with patient’s physician in ascertaining the need for home care and in developing, implementing and revising the Plan of Care.
- Perform initial patient assessment on those patients admitted to the agency for care.
- Develop an individualized goal outcome Plan of Care.
- Provide and supervise care according to the Plan of Care.
- Ensure that physician’s orders are obtained initially, reviewed as required and communicated appropriately.
- Assist with home maker and HHA supervision.
- Develop the Aide Plan of Care reflecting initial patient assessment and Plan of Care.
- Assess the appropriateness/effectiveness of all paraprofessional caregivers on a regular basis and annually.
- Submit and maintain accurate and timely documentation to client care.
- Document supervisory visits.
- Other related duties as assigned.
